M.E.D AREA WITHIN ALLOCATION

Electricity consumption in the M.E.D. area for the week which enaea yesterday was 98.9 per cent. ofMhe allocation, said the chairman of the City Council’s electricity committee (Mr L. G. Amos) last evening. The committee has decided to Permit commercial lighting from midday to 9.15 p.m., instead of froth 3 p.m., and domestic water heaters may now be used from 2 p.m. to 6,0. m., giving a total of 22 hours in the day. The only period in which water heaters must not be used is between noon and 2 p.m.
